Biography

Frithjof Benjamin Schenk is a distinguished scholar in the field of History, currently serving as the Head of the Department of History at the University of Basel. He has an extensive academic background with a strong focus on the theory and history of images, guided by his involvement in the Graduate School eikones. His research interests explore the intersections between visual culture and historical narrative, contributing significantly to our understanding of how images shape historical perspectives. Schenk's publications and academic endeavors have garnered recognition within the scholarly community, positioning him as a thought leader in his discipline.
